Handbook of Evolutionary Machine Learning: Genetic and Evolutionary Computation As technology continues to advance at an unprecedented rate, it is crucial that we understand the process of its development and how it impacts our society. The Handbook of Evolutionary Machine Learning: Genetic and Evolutionary Computation provides a comprehensive overview of the intersection of evolutionary approaches and machine learning, offering insights into the future of technological advancements and their potential impact on humanity. This book, written by leading international researchers in the field, explores various ways in which evolution can address machine learning problems and improve current methods. Part One: Fundamental Concepts and Overviews The first part of the book introduces fundamental concepts and overviews of evolutionary approaches to the three different classes of learning employed in machine learning: supervised, unsupervised, and reinforcement learning. These chapters provide a solid foundation for understanding the principles of evolutionary machine learning and its applications. Part Two: Evolutionary Computation as a Machine Learning Technique The second part delves into the use of evolutionary computation as a machine learning technique, describing methodological improvements for evolutionary clustering, classification, regression, and ensemble learning. These chapters demonstrate the versatility and effectiveness of evolutionary approaches in solving complex machine learning problems.
